To reset a compact (non-rack-mounted) security appliance or teleworker gateway to the factory defaults, press the button labeled Reset on the back panel of the security appliance for 10-15 seconds. A security vulnerability was discovered in the Local Status Page functionality of Cisco Meraki’s MX67 and MX68 security appliance models that may allow unauthenticated individuals to access and download logs containing sensitive, privileged device information.
